Блог
Резисторы являются важными компонентами электронных схем, которые контролируют поток электрического тока. Чтобы определить значение сопротивления резистора, производители используют систему цветового кодирования. В этой статье мы рассмотрим различные методы определения номинала резистора сопротивлением 270 Ом с использованием его цветных полос. Кроме того, мы добавим примеры кода, которые помогут в процессе декодирования.
Метод 1: ручное декодирование
Цветные полосы резистора указывают значение его сопротивления, допуск и иногда температурный коэффициент. Стандартный цветовой код четырехполосного резистора включает три полосы для значения сопротивления и одну полосу для допуска. Вот цветовой код резистора сопротивлением 270 Ом:
Диапазон 1: красный (2)
Диапазон 2: фиолетовый (7)
Диапазон 3: черный (x1)
Диапазон 4: золотой (допуск ±5%)
Для расчета сопротивления объединяем первые две цифры (27) и умножаем их на 10, возведенную в степень третьей цифры (х1). Таким образом, значение сопротивления составляет 270 Ом.
Метод 2: пример кода Python
Чтобы автоматизировать процесс декодирования, мы можем написать простую функцию Python, которая принимает цвета в качестве входных данных и возвращает значение сопротивления. Вот пример:
def decode_resistor(colors):
    color_values = {
        'black': 0, 'brown': 1, 'red': 2, 'orange': 3,
        'yellow': 4, 'green': 5, 'blue': 6, 'violet': 7,
        'gray': 8, 'white': 9
    }
    significant_digits = color_values[colors[0]] * 10 + color_values[colors[1]]
    resistance = significant_digits * pow(10, color_values[colors[2]])
    return resistance
colors = ['red', 'violet', 'black']
resistor_value = decode_resistor(colors)
print(f"The resistance value is {resistor_value} ohms.")Выход:
The resistance value is 270 ohms.Метод 3: онлайн-калькуляторы цветового кода
Для расшифровки цветовых кодов резисторов доступно несколько онлайн-инструментов и мобильных приложений. Эти инструменты позволяют вводить цвета и мгновенно получать значение сопротивления. Они удобны и полезны для быстрых расчетов.
Расшифровка цветовой кодировки резисторов — важный навык для любого, кто работает с электронными схемами. В этой статье мы рассмотрели различные методы определения значения сопротивления резистора сопротивлением 270 Ом. Мы обсудили ручное декодирование, привели пример кода Python и упомянули доступность онлайн-инструментов. Зная цветовой код резистора, вы можете легко определить значение сопротивления любого резистора и обеспечить точность проектирования схемы.